Misc Changes (#306)

This commit is contained in:
Pheenoh
2023-03-07 18:03:46 -07:00
committed by GitHub
parent 6c2e18af70
commit f31ab5ae0b
89 changed files with 11095 additions and 1436 deletions
-2
View File
@@ -132,8 +132,6 @@ extern "C" void _restgpr_26();
extern "C" void _restgpr_27();
extern "C" void _restgpr_28();
extern "C" void _restgpr_29();
extern "C" extern void* g_fopScn_Method[5 + 1 /* padding */];
extern "C" extern void* g_fpcNd_Method[5 + 1 /* padding */];
extern "C" extern void* __vt__10dDlst_2D_c[3];
extern "C" u8 m_cpadInfo__8mDoCPd_c[256];
extern "C" void* mRenderModeObj__15mDoMch_render_c[1 + 1 /* padding */];
+21 -26
View File
@@ -1,33 +1,28 @@
//
// Generated By: dol2asm
// Translation Unit: d/s/d_s_menu
//
/**
* d_s_menu.cpp
* dolzel2 - Scene Menu
*/
#include "d/s/d_s_menu.h"
#include "dol2asm.h"
#include "dolphin/types.h"
#include "d/d_procname.h"
#include "f_pc/f_pc_node.h"
#include "f_pc/f_pc_leaf.h"
#include "f_op/f_op_scene.h"
//
// Forward References:
//
extern "C" extern void* g_profile_MENU_SCENE[10];
//
// External References:
//
extern "C" extern void* g_fopScn_Method[5 + 1 /* padding */];
extern "C" extern void* g_fpcNd_Method[5 + 1 /* padding */];
//
// Declarations:
//
/* ############################################################################################## */
/* 803C3018-803C3040 -00001 0028+00 0/0 0/0 1/0 .data g_profile_MENU_SCENE */
SECTION_DATA extern void* g_profile_MENU_SCENE[10] = {
(void*)NULL, (void*)0x0001FFFD, (void*)0x000A0000, (void*)&g_fpcNd_Method,
(void*)NULL, (void*)NULL, (void*)NULL, (void*)&g_fopScn_Method,
(void*)NULL, (void*)NULL,
extern scene_process_profile_definition g_profile_MENU_SCENE = {
0, // mLayerID
1, // mListID
-3, // mListPrio
PROC_MENU_SCENE, // mProcName
0, // padding
&g_fpcNd_Method.mBase, // mSubMtd
0, // mSize
0, // mSizeOther
0, // mParameters
&g_fopScn_Method.mBase, // mSubMtd
0, // mpMtd
0 // padding
};
+2 -2
View File
@@ -181,8 +181,8 @@ extern "C" void __register_global_object();
extern "C" void __ptmf_scall();
extern "C" void _savegpr_28();
extern "C" void _restgpr_28();
extern "C" extern void* g_fopScn_Method[5 + 1 /* padding */];
extern "C" extern void* g_fpcNd_Method[5 + 1 /* padding */];
// extern "C" extern void* g_fopScn_Method[5 + 1 /* padding */];
// extern "C" extern void* g_fpcNd_Method[5 + 1 /* padding */];
extern "C" void* mRenderModeObj__15mDoMch_render_c[1 + 1 /* padding */];
extern "C" u8 mFader__13mDoGph_gInf_c[4];
extern "C" u8 mResetData__6mDoRst[4 + 4 /* padding */];
+2 -2
View File
@@ -182,8 +182,8 @@ extern "C" void _savegpr_29();
extern "C" void _restgpr_26();
extern "C" void _restgpr_28();
extern "C" void _restgpr_29();
extern "C" extern void* g_fopScn_Method[5 + 1 /* padding */];
extern "C" extern void* g_fpcNd_Method[5 + 1 /* padding */];
// extern "C" extern void* g_fopScn_Method[5 + 1 /* padding */];
// extern "C" extern void* g_fpcNd_Method[5 + 1 /* padding */];
extern "C" extern void* __vt__14mDoHIO_entry_c[3];
extern "C" u8 m_bloom__13mDoGph_gInf_c[20];
extern "C" u8 mLineCheck__11fopAcM_lc_c[112];
+2 -2
View File
@@ -104,8 +104,8 @@ extern "C" void _restgpr_27();
extern "C" void _restgpr_28();
extern "C" void _restgpr_29();
extern "C" void strnicmp();
extern "C" extern void* g_fopScn_Method[5 + 1 /* padding */];
extern "C" extern void* g_fpcNd_Method[5 + 1 /* padding */];
// extern "C" extern void* g_fopScn_Method[5 + 1 /* padding */];
// extern "C" extern void* g_fpcNd_Method[5 + 1 /* padding */];
extern "C" u8 mStatus__20dStage_roomControl_c[65792];
extern "C" u8 mDemoArcName__20dStage_roomControl_c[10 + 2 /* padding */];
extern "C" u8 mResetData__6mDoRst[4 + 4 /* padding */];
+33 -32
View File
@@ -1,41 +1,42 @@
//
// Generated By: dol2asm
// Translation Unit: d/s/d_s_title
//
/**
* d_s_title.cpp
* dolzel2 - Scene Title
*/
#include "d/s/d_s_title.h"
#include "dol2asm.h"
#include "dolphin/types.h"
//
// Forward References:
//
extern "C" extern void* g_profile_WARNING_SCENE[10];
extern "C" extern void* g_profile_WARNING2_SCENE[10];
//
// External References:
//
extern "C" extern void* g_fopScn_Method[5 + 1 /* padding */];
extern "C" extern void* g_fpcNd_Method[5 + 1 /* padding */];
//
// Declarations:
//
#include "f_op/f_op_scene.h"
#include "f_pc/f_pc_leaf.h"
#include "d/d_procname.h"
/* ############################################################################################## */
/* 803C32B0-803C32D8 -00001 0028+00 0/0 0/0 1/0 .data g_profile_WARNING_SCENE */
SECTION_DATA extern void* g_profile_WARNING_SCENE[10] = {
(void*)NULL, (void*)0x0001FFFD, (void*)0x000F0000, (void*)&g_fpcNd_Method,
(void*)0x00000204, (void*)NULL, (void*)NULL, (void*)&g_fopScn_Method,
(void*)NULL, (void*)NULL,
extern scene_process_profile_definition g_profile_WARNING_SCENE = {
0, // mLayerID
1, // mListID
-3, // mListPrio
PROC_WARNING_SCENE, // mProcName
0, // padding
&g_fpcNd_Method.mBase, // mSubMtd
0x00000204, // mSize
0, // mSizeOther
0, // mParameters
&g_fopScn_Method.mBase, // mSubMtd
0, // mpMtd
0 // padding
};
/* 803C32D8-803C3300 -00001 0028+00 0/0 0/0 1/0 .data g_profile_WARNING2_SCENE */
SECTION_DATA extern void* g_profile_WARNING2_SCENE[10] = {
(void*)NULL, (void*)0x0001FFFD, (void*)0x00100000, (void*)&g_fpcNd_Method,
(void*)0x00000204, (void*)NULL, (void*)NULL, (void*)&g_fopScn_Method,
(void*)NULL, (void*)NULL,
extern scene_process_profile_definition g_profile_WARNING2_SCENE = {
0, // mLayerID
1, // mListID
-3, // mListPrio
PROC_WARNING2_SCENE, // mProcName
0, // padding
&g_fpcNd_Method.mBase, // mSubMtd
0x00000204, // mSize
0, // mSizeOther
0, // mParameters
&g_fopScn_Method.mBase, // mSubMtd
0, // mpMtd
0 // padding
};